STEVENS, Wallace HARMONIUM
New York Knopf 1923 First Edition One of 500 copies in the first
binding of checked boards of perhaps the most important first book of
poetry of the 20th century. Edelstein A I.a. Spine label just a tad
darkened but very readable. Virtually no edgewear and unusual thus.
Just about Fine, lacking the scarce dustwrapper. $5000
